Resurgence in mid-box shed market

It has been a testing period for the commercial property market in 2020, for the obvious reasons. Office, retail and hospitality sectors have suffered from the impact of COVID-19 and ever-changing government restrictions. The industrial and logistics sector has, however, proved extremely resilient throughout, which is hopefully a positive sign for the market and the economy as a whole.

The success of the big box market (warehouses in excess of 100,000 square feet) has been well publicised and is probably the only sector to have actually benefited from the upheaval of COVID-19, as a result of the significant increase in online retail sales. Statistics actually suggest a UK-wide vacancy rate of less than 5%, which has pushed rents on significantly. The smaller end of the industrial sector also got going quickly after the first lockdown period, as their operations are more naturally spread out.

In recent months, we are also pleased to report that the mid-box sector has also picked up, comprising circa 30,000 to 80,000 square feet. This market generally has growing local and regional operators, or larger UK/world businesses that prefer hubs. Despite everything that is going on in the world, particularly COVID-19 and Brexit, this sector is starting to grow in confidence, as we appear to see the light at the end of the tunnel.

There are some good examples of this in Northamptonshire. In a search and acquisition role, we have recently acted for MCC Labels in acquiring circa 50,000 square feet of space on Heartlands in Daventry. MCC are expanding their operation in the town. Another example is the letting of 40,000 square feet at Round Spinney in Northampton, where acting for the landlord we have let space to Keen & Able, a Northampton-based company that has taken the building as additional space to its existing operation. 

We have also let circa 25,000 square feet to Ubbink, part of Centrotec SE Group, who are relocating from an existing facility in Northampton to underpin the company’s growth strategy.

So, not just positive thinking, but examples of increasing occupier confidence in both the market and Northamptonshire and the wider region. We have set out some examples of mid box opportunities we have on the market currently.
